Lining Up: How do improvement programmes work?
This learning report looks at lessons from the Health Foundation’s Lining Up research project – an investigation into interventions to reduce central line infections. It explores the reasons why potentially promising improvement programmes might fall short when implemented in a new setting.
Quality improvement made simple This guide looks at organisational or industrial approaches to quality improvement. This is not a ‘how to’ guide. Instead, it offers a clear explanation of some common approaches used to improve quality, including where they have come from, their underlying principles and their efficacy and applicability within the healthcare arena
